VV Alkmaar vs Jong PSV, 2022-23 KNVB Beker Vrouwen, Quarterfinals

Match Timeline
- 0': Lineups are announced and players are warming up.
- 0': First Half begins.
- 45'+2': First Half ends, Alkmaar Women 0, Jong PSV Women 0.
- 45': Second Half begins Alkmaar Women 0, Jong PSV Women 0.
- 60': Goal! Alkmaar Women 0, Jong PSV Women 1. Dieke van Straten (Jong PSV Women)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the high centre of the goal. Assisted by Maxime Snellenberg.
- 70': Substitution, Alkmaar Women. Elfi Maass replaces Judith Roosjen.
- 70': Substitution, Alkmaar Women. Ilvy Zijp replaces Veerle van der Most.
- 80': Robine Lacroix (Jong PSV Women)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 81': Substitution, Jong PSV Women. Janne Verbakel replaces Shanique Dessing.
- 84': Substitution, Alkmaar Women. Bo Anna Op de Weegh replaces Manique de Vette.
- 84': Substitution, Alkmaar Women. Isabelle Nottet replaces Ginia Caprino.
- 90'+5': Second Half ends, Alkmaar Women 0, Jong PSV Women 1.
- 0': Match ends, Alkmaar Women 0, Jong PSV Women 1.
Game Information
Venue: Sportpark AFC '34
Location: Alkmaar, Netherlands
Attendance: 200
